Seventh grade teacher Dana Rutgers never asks all of her students to complete the same

assignment because some students are working below grade level and some exceed grade level
expectations. When this teacher varies and adjusts instruction and assignments to address
individual differences, she is practicing:

a) differentiated instruction
b) balanced literacy
c) the Accelerated Reader System
d) Whole Language Instruction


a
